The Fastest Growing Cosmetic Procedure Isn’t What You Think

News flash! The fastest growing cosmetic procedure probably isn’t one you’d expect.

A recent report published by the American Society of Plastic Surgeons contains several surprising statistics. However, one thing is for sure. The demand for plastic surgery continues to grow, as a result of technological advancements and a wider range of available options. Continue reading, to learn more.

Buttock Augmentation

And the winner is… buttock augmentation. Data indicates that buttock implants and lifts are among the fastest-growing surgeries available. Fat injections remain to be minimally invasive, regardless of the specific area of the body that is receiving them. This type of surgery was up two percent, from 2013 to 2014. Fat grafting was up 15 percent, for the same time period.

Top Five Procedures

The top 5 minimally-invasive procedures, for this period, include:

  • Botox
  • Soft tissue fillers
  • Chemical peels
  • Laser hair removal
  • Microdermabrasion

The top five surgical procedures include:

  • Breast augmentation
  • Nose reshaping
  • Liposuction
  • Eyelid surgery
  • Facelift

Plastic Surgery and Men and the Fastest Growing Cosmetic Procedure

According to the ASPS report, more men are taking advantage of plastic surgery than ever before. In all honesty, why shouldn’t they? Self image is becoming just as important for the male population as it has been for women. The most popular procedures for men are currently male breast reduction and pectoral implants.

Breast Reconstruction and Cancer Patients

Breast reconstruction is very important for cancer patients who wish to maintain the highest quality of life possible. In 2014, these procedures increased by 7 percent. This is due in part to a Breast Reconstruction Awareness Campaign, launched by the ASPS.

The organization hopes that the campaign will help to educate and empower women to make the most informed decisions, after receiving the diagnosis of breast cancer.  Unfortunately, many women are completely unaware of all of the options available when it comes to reconstructive surgery.
